摘要
本文综述了近年来有关地上部植物信息化合物在植物一害虫一天敌三营养级关系中的信息联系,分析地上部植物信息化合物在植物一害虫、植物一天敌、植物个体内和个体间信号传递的生态学功能,阐明地上部植物信息化合物在害虫治理中的应用潜力,包括害虫诱捕和诱杀、昆虫种群监测、植物拒避剂、干扰害虫对寄主搜索、“推一拉”策略和植物内源激发子的应用等,讨论了地上部植物信息化合物与其他控害手段的协同作用,以及在生产实践中可能存在的相关问题,旨在为地上部植物信息化合物在害虫持续治理中的应用提供科学指导。
Recently, infochemical communication within a tritrophic system (plant-herbivore-enemy) has been heavily investigated. This paper describes the ecological functions of aboveground plant infochemicals on within-plant, inter-plant, plant-to-herbivore, and plant-to-natural enemy signaling, as well as the application of aboveground plant infoehemicals toward pest management. Aboveground plant infochemicals can be used as tools for attracting and killing insects, mass trapping, insect population monitoring, repelling, disrupting host seeking, pushing and pulling, and endogenous elicitation. These infoehemieals can not only be used alone but also integrated with other approaches, such as visual cues, pheromones, biocontrols, chemical pesticides, and genetically engineered plants. Strategies for promoting the practical application of plant infoehemicals are also discussed in some detail.
